Today Oliver talks to Ana Salamasina and Tiana Collins about Blind Low Vision NZ and Aka Ora.
Ana Salamasina – a current member / client of BLVNZ and member of Aka Ora – Pasifika and Māori members support group was. In
2003 she was diagnosed with Keratoconus which is an eye condition that affects the cornea (the clear tissue covering the front of the eye).
Ana has a cornea graph, cataracts, laser, and injections to the eye as treatment for Keratoconus. However, Ana’s vision continued to deteriorate in in 2018 she lost all her vision. She was referred to BLVNZ in 2017 and has accessed services such as white cane training (as part of orientation and mobility services), also support with leaning to use the speech related apps on her phone.
Aka Ora – which is a support group for Pasifika and Māori clients started almost a year ago.
Members share a connection through their cultures while supporting each other through their own journey with navigating the world as part of the blind and low vision community. Ana is part of the leadership group.
Tiana Collins – Community Liaison for Pasifika based in Wellington.
Tiana is an advocate for better awareness of Blind Low Vision NZ services and linking our Pasifika and Māori communities to access services that support for their independence at part of the blind and low vision community. This includes supporting the support groups, supporting access to services and resources, as well as linking members to wider networks across the communities and spaces they are part of.
